Chapter 17
âWell, Iâd say that was a resounding success!â Chase beamed at her.
Willow nodded in relief and flipped the lights off in front of the diner. The place had been packed with people eager to welcome Chase home and the crowd had eaten through her party sandwiches with great enthusiasm.
âI still wonder what was going on with Cider?â She looked down at her dog, who stood at her side happily wagging her tail and patiently waiting for the walk home.
âItâs been a stressful couple of days for all of us, hasnât it, girl?â Chase bent down and stroked Ciderâs head. âYou headed home now?â
âYep.â Willow glanced around the clean diner and motioned for Chase to follow her through the kitchen and out the back door. She snapped the leash to Ciderâs collar. âWe walked today soâ¦,â
âMind if I walk with you?â Chase asked.
Willow smiled. âOf course not,â she said as the three of them walked out to the sidewalk.
They walked in companionable silence, taking in the sights and sounds of their sleepy little town. The wind was cool, but Willow found herself feeling so warm thanks to Chaseâs presence beside her.
âThank you for putting on such a wonderful party back there,â Chase said with a smile. âIt was really nice to see all my old friends again. It meant so much to me, even if the meatloaf and pecan pie were no-shows.â
Willow couldnât believe her ears. Here he was thanking her. She had been worried that no one would show up or that if people did show up, theyâd be too afraid to eat her food, but here he was expressing his gratitude towards her efforts.
âNo. Thank you for suggesting the party in the first place,â Willow said gratefully. âIt got people through the door and back into the diner, and they ate my food. It might be just what the diner needed to get customers back in the seats and enjoying their meals. I canât thank you enough.â
âGlad I could help,â Chase smiled gently, and she felt the butterflies flutter in her stomach again.
âThough, it wonât really make a difference if people still think I poisoned Sarah or that they might be poisoned at the diner,â she pointed out to distract herself from his heartfelt smile and the reaction it produced in her. âI have to clear my name and the dinerâs reputation.â
Chase nodded and looked thoughtful. âI just got that job renovating the offices of the town lawyerââ
âYou got the job? Thatâs so great! Congratulations!â She bumped her shoulder on his as they walked.
âThank you,â he nudged her back. âBut Iâm still happy to help with this investigation.â
âThat would mean so much. Thank you,â she said, hoping she sounded as genuine as she felt, with excitement and genuine gratitude.
He chuckled at her happiness and swiped Ciderâs leash out of her hands as they walked. Cider glanced up and noted the exchange but wagged her tail in happy acceptance and continued down the sidewalk.
âSo, whatâs the latest? Whoâs at the top of your list?â
Willow took a deep breath and let out a long sigh.
